However, the situation has become far more complicated. The company that held the licensing rights, PassportMusic, stopped doing business around 2020, and official support for Encore was formally discontinued. While a so-called "Revived Passport" took over from GVOX in 2023, the new owner has never indicated he would support Encore 5. The new Passport owner has stated that he hadn't the server with the customer base files and does not sell nor repair Encore 5 licenses.
